How Emergency Water Removal (24/7) Actually Works

Our team’s process for Emergency Water Removal (24/7) is carefully designed to ensure your property is restored to its original condition. We understand that every minute counts when dealing with water damage, which is why we take a step-by-step approach to ensure everything is done correctly and efficiently.

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our certified technicians will arrive at your property and conduct a thorough assessment of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ak or flood, and develop a plan to safely remove the water and dry out your property. This process typically takes around 30 minutes to an hour.

Quick and thorough assessment of the damage, accurate identification of the source, and clear communication of the plan.

Step 2: Water Removal

Using specialized equipment, our team will carefully extract the water from your property, including carpets, upholstery, and drywall. This process can take anywhere from 2-6 hours,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Efficient water removal using equipment designed for this purpose, careful handling of sensitive areas, and regular updates on our progress.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been removed,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your property and remove any remaining moisture. This process can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Thorough drying of your property, effective removal of moisture, and regular monitoring to ensure everything is dry.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

After the drying process is complete, our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ize your property to remove any remaining bacteria, mold, and mildew. This process typically takes around 1-2 hours,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Thorough cleaning of your property, effective sanitizing to prevent future issues, and regular updates on our progress.

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air

Finally, our team will work with you to repair and reconstruct any areas of your property that were damaged by the flood. This can include replacing drywall, flooring, and other structural elements.

Effective repair of your property, careful attention to detail, and regular updates on our progress.

Emergency Water Removal (24/7) Cost In Villa Rica, GA

The cost of Emergency Water Removal (24/7) in Villa Rica, GA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ions.
Cleaning and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ions.
Reconstruction and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ions.
Equipment rental and usage $100 – $500 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ions.
Travel and labor costs $200 – $1,000 Distance from our location, time of day, and severity of the damage.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to help you plan and budget for the service.
